Understanding Malta Citizenship Requirements: A Comprehensive Guide
Securing the nationality can appear challenging, but this guide aims to clarify the necessary steps. Generally, applicants must demonstrate a genuine link to Malta. This may involve achieved through several paths, including investment schemes.
- Investment Options: Consider the Malta Naturalisation Program, which involves a considerable financial contribution and a timeframe of stay.
- Exceptional Services: Individuals who provide outstanding assistance to the nation may also be eligible.
- By Descent: Status may be assigned through heritage if you have Malta parents.
- Marriage: A union to a citizen may result in status after a specified period.
The Maltese Naturalization by Contribution Program : New Guidelines
The Malta Citizenship by Investment Program has undergone substantial changes to its regulations , impacting potential applicants. These amendments aim to enhance the due diligence process and ensure greater levels of accountability. Key features of the updated framework include stricter background reviews, enhanced evaluation of applicant sources of capital , and a required residency duration before final citizenship approval . Individuals should now expect a more protracted process and increased charges. For detailed information, prospective applicants are advised to review the government documentation and obtain professional legal assistance .
